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: 1. Patients with acute ischemic stroke meet the following conditions: 1) Age =18 years old; 2) Anterior circulation vessel occlusion confirmed by CTA/MRA/DSA (ICA, MCA M1 or M2 segment); 3) NCCT/MRI-DWI ASPECTS score 3-5 or CTP core infarction volume (rCBF <30%) 50-150ml; 4) eTICI= 2B 50 after EVT treatment; 5) NIHSS score =10 before EVT treatment. 2. Patients with subarachnoid hemorrhage meet the following conditions: 1) Age =18 years old; 2) CT confirmed subarachnoid hemorrhage; 3) mFisher grade 2-4; 4) WFNS grade II-V. 3, patients with cerebral hemorrhage, meet the following conditions: 1) Age =18 years old; 2) CT confirmed cerebral hemorrhage, acute (within 72 hours) or subacute (3 days to 3 weeks); 3) Glasgow Coma Scale (GCS) < 15 points. 4. Patients with perioperative temperature control shall meet the following conditions: 1) Age =18 years old; 2) General anesthesia or combined anesthesia; 3) The duration of anesthesia is expected to exceed 2 hours.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: 1) Serious infectious diseases, serious coagulopathy, suffering from serious heart, lung and other diseases; 2) Infection in the puncture areaabnormal anatomy of the puncture site; 3) Allergic to heat exchange catheters; 4) Serious hepatic and renal insufficiency; 5) Pregnant and lactating women and those who plan to get pregnant within one year; 6) Participants who participated in clinical trials of any drug and/or medical device within 3 months prior to enrollment; 7) The researcher considers that there are any other factors that are not suitable for inclusion or affect the participant's participation in the study.
